Tips To Choose The Right Fitness Center For You
Find What Fits YOU
Just because a gym has great reviews and tons of members doesn’t mean it’s necessarily a good fit for YOU. For example, our boxing fitness center in Houston is perfect for full body cardio and endurance training. However, what if you have special needs such as aquatic cardio due to arthritis or injury? You will want to find a gym with a pool that is easily accessible.
Also, make sure the gym’s culture fits you. If you want to avoid wasting time; before you drive through Houston traffic to visit a gym, check them out online first, see what they offer, look at virtual tours, and be mindful of their offerings.
Once you have vetted a few gymsonline and made notes on what you like or don’t like about each one, then you go and visit to get a feel in person.
Make sure to not only consider any good reviews for a particular club, but also the bad reviews.
Let The Demand Work In Your Favor
Since January sees the annual rush of people seeking to join a gym for the new year, many clubs and fitness centers offer huge discounts or incentives to get you to sign up. Don’t take the first offer you get. Make note of who’s offering what and if you have a club in mind, try to get them to match the competitions offers or beat them.
If you play your cards rightand ask to speak to the club manager—you might just score yourself a real steal of a deal, just be persistent and ready to turn them down if you don’t get what you want. Your leverage may end up getting your perks not normally offered in the packages they are advertising.
Keep An Eye Out For New Locations
While this is good anytime during the year when a new gym is opening, January gives you even more leverage due to the demand we mentioned already. Keep an eye out for well-known chains opening new locations and new brands entering the market in your area. Many will offer crazy good deals if you sign up before the location is open for business. With gym and fitness centers in Houston being one of the most popular types of franchises, there are new locations popping up all over the metro area every month. It should be noted, however, that you want to make sure you ask about access to their other locations around the city or country so you aren’t tied down to just one location.
Give The Gym A Test Run
Most gyms will offer you guest passes or trial memberships of varying lengths. Take full advantage of these to really get an idea of the atmosphere, the crowd, the traffic and machine availability, and the condition of the equipment.
When you give a gym a test run like this, you get a real idea of how hard or easy it is to get to the location, the travel time, how the staff cares for member’s needs, and whether or not it is properly equipped for the numberof active members at any given moment.
Watch Out For Hidden Costs And Clauses

If you are interested in a gym, ask about extra fees for any activities or classes you’re interested in. Ask about cancellation fees and contract renewal terms. Also,ask about any other amenities that may cost extra.
Basically,you want to know what your base membership gets you, what it doesn’t include, and if there are any incidental charges you could incur.
